WAKE is based on mermaid myth. Gemma and Harper are sisters
who are totally opposite and yet complement each other.
Harper is practical, straightforward, and a little
overprotective of her little sister; Gemma is carefree,
pretty, and totally in love with swimming. Everything's
normal until three gorgeous girls show up. Penn, Lexi and
Thea, caught everyone's attention, not just because of their
beauty, but because something's eerie with them. The next
thing Gemma knows, she's different. She'd become stronger,
faster and more beautiful. Now she must face the decision of
staying with the ones she loves or embracing her new powers
in a world too dark to imagine.
The plot is good; we have the family issues, sisterly bonds
and fights, developing love interest, one is complicated and
the other is too innocent..:)..the unnaturally beautiful
girls who showed out of nowhere, their sudden interest to
our heroine, the mermaid thing. I say it's amazing how
Hocking mixed all this things to arrive with WAKE.
What I love about WAKE is that we're given two
perspectives, thatof Harper and that of Gemma. I actually
first thought that it's just about Gemma, but as the story
progress, we see a lot from Harper. We see the story unfold
in 2 different ways. We're given insights into what happens
on the other side. Plus, I love the romance. Gemma and the
boy next door, Alex, is cute, but its Harper and Daniel's
romance that greatly affect me. It's cute, funny, with
enough tension and challenge for both of them.
Hocking's brought to life her characters with their depth
and unique personality. In WAKE, the characters develop as
the story goes on. The descriptions were vivid and
mysterious
enough to keep me going. Some readers might find the
pacing a bit slow, but it is the first book in a series, so
I believe that Hocking is giving the details we will need
as the series progresses. The
conversation meanwhile, is genuine and humorous.
WAKE, although a mermaid folktale, is more a tale of
sisterly
bond, that no matter what, a sister is a sister, it's a bond
that can't be broken by differences, tastes, or myth.
Creepy, beautiful with a different take on mermaid lore,
WAKE ends in a cliffhanger that will make everyone crave
for Lullaby---the next book in the series.
